Job Description

Wharton Arts is seeking a new Director of Finance to work closely with the new President and Chief Executive Officer, driving change that promotes stability and prepares for future growth of the organization’s well-regarded programs. The annual budget is approximately $4 million, and the organization employs 18 full-time and 120 part-time employees across three locations, serving 2,000 students each year with community music and creative youth development programs.

The Director of Finance is responsible for all financial records, financial strategy, reporting and analysis.

Responsibilities Finance
  • Responsible for budget and forecasting processes.
  • Partners with CEO in formulating strategy.
  • Interfaces with four Program Directors on budget and forecasting updates.
  • Prepares financial reporting for Board Finance Committee and Board meetings.
  • Manages student financial aid/scholarship process.
  • Provides ad hoc financial analysis needed for business decisions, board inquiries, tour financing, etc.
  • Supports Development with financial schedules and reporting for all Grant applications/reports.
Risk Management Oversight
  • Reviews monthly financial close, approving all adjusting and closing entries.
  • Manages annual audit and annual federal and state filings with external auditors.
  • Provides representation in banking relationship.
  • Approves payroll.
  • Interfaces with insurance agent on matters involving insurance policies.
  • Completes biannual small business certification.
Decision Making Authority
  • All contracts impacting finances.
  • Spending authorizations within approved budgets/forecasts.
Reports To

President and Chief Executive Officer

Supervises

Comptroller

Skills / Qualifications
  • Certified Public Accountant (current preferred)
  • Proficiency in Quick Books, Excel, Word, Power Point
  • Efficiency and organization skills
  • Ability to handle multiple deadlines at once
  • Nonprofit experience preferred
